Recall number R/2001/099


There are 4166 SAAB vehicles affected by the recall R/2001/099.

This recall was issued on October 4th, 2001 and all the details of this SAAB recall (R/2001/099 - UNINTENTIONAL DEPLOYMENT OF PASSENGER AIR BAG) are provided bellow:



Recall reference

R/2001/099

Recall Type

Car

Recall Date

2001-10-04

Reason for concern

UNINTENTIONAL DEPLOYMENT OF PASSENGER AIR BAG

Reason for recall

A build up of static electricity may cause unintentional deployment of the front passenger air bag.

Remedy

Recall affected vehicles and fit a grounding wire between the air bag module and the vehicle body.

How to check if the vehicle is recalled

Contact the local SAAB dealership or manufacturer. You will not need to pay for anything involving the recall.

How the manufacturer will repair

The Recalled vehicles will have the fixing checked and corrected as necessary by and official SAAB service.
